USA, CO: New Belgium Brewing to open a small brewery in Denver in the first quarter of 2017
Brewery news

New Belgium Brewing is planting serious stakes in Denver with a satellite brewhouse in the River North neighbourhood, The Denver Post reported on July 22.

The Fort Collins-based company — Colorado's largest independent craft brewery — on July 21 announced plans to open a 10-barrel pilot brewery as part of the $41 million, 100-room The Source Hotel.

The project, expected to open in the first quarter of 2017, will be attached to The Source, an artisan marketplace and food emporium in Fort Collins.

Veteran RiNo Hotel’s developers Mickey and Kyle Zeppelin are leading the project.

New Belgium Brewing's move to experiment on a small scale in Denver dovetails with a couple of currents in the craft beer industry — beer aficionados' insatiable thirst for something different and the pairing of complex, ambitious beer.

"In the craft beer community, beer drinkers are always looking for what's new and what is changing and how brewers are pushing the envelope forward," said New Belgium Brewing’s spokesman Bryan Simpson. "You want to keep up with innovation and constantly imagining new things."

The 2,000-square-foot New Belgium Brewing's brewery will be housed on the RiNo Hotel’s ground floor.

New Belgium Brewing’s officials say they have long considered a Denver location to reach a broader audience, including tourists.
